Most people get better in a few weeks, but for some people, it can take longer – sometimes … Witryna17 mar 2024 · "And those substances are clove, lemon, eucalyptus and rose. And what we recommend is that patients smell these substances for 15 seconds, twice a day for several weeks or several months. And this has been associated with significant improvements in the ability to taste and smell," says Dr. Vanichkachorn.
